How long does it take for the Medical beauty project Cryolipolysis in Hobart?

If you're considering undergoing cryolipolysis in Hobart, you may be wondering how long the procedure takes and what you can expect during the treatment. Cryolipolysis, also known as fat freezing, is a popular non-invasive medical beauty procedure that aims to reduce stubborn pockets of fat by freezing and eliminating the fat cells. It is a safe and effective alternative to surgical fat reduction procedures, such as liposuction. In this article, we will delve into the details of the cryolipolysis procedure and discuss the timeframe involved.

How long does it take for the Medical beauty project Cryolipolysis in Hobart

Understanding Cryolipolysis

Cryolipolysis works by exposing targeted areas of the body to extreme cold temperatures, which causes fat cells to undergo a natural cell death process known as apoptosis. Over time, the body naturally eliminates these dead fat cells, resulting in a gradual reduction of fat in the treated area. The procedure is precise, allowing for localized fat reduction in specific problem areas such as the abdomen, thighs, love handles, or chin.

Before undergoing cryolipolysis, it is crucial to consult with a qualified medical professional or dermatologist to assess your suitability for the procedure and discuss your aesthetic goals. The treatment is not suitable for individuals with certain medical conditions, so it is essential to disclose any underlying health issues during your consultation.

The Cryolipolysis Procedure

The cryolipolysis procedure typically involves the following steps:

1. Consultation

Your journey towards a slimmer physique begins with an initial consultation. During this meeting, your medical professional will evaluate your specific concerns, assess your eligibility for cryolipolysis, and discuss the expected outcomes. This step is essential for setting realistic expectations and understanding the potential benefits and risks.

2. Preparing for the Treatment

Prior to your cryolipolysis session, no special preparations are usually required. It is recommended to wear loose and comfortable clothing on the day of the treatment to ensure ease of access to the targeted areas. You may also be advised to avoid certain medications or substances that thin your blood, as this can increase the likelihood of bruising.

3. Application of the Cooling Device

Once you are comfortably positioned on a treatment bed, the cryolipolysis applicator will be placed on the targeted area. The applicator suctions the skin and fat into an enclosed chamber, where controlled cooling is applied to the specific area. The temperature is precisely controlled to reach and maintain temperatures that trigger fat cell death while keeping the surrounding tissues unharmed.

4. Duration of the Treatment

The duration of a cryolipolysis session varies depending on the size and number of the treatment areas. Typically, a single treatment session lasts between 35 to 60 minutes. However, if multiple areas are being treated simultaneously, the duration may be longer. During the treatment, you can relax, read a book, or engage in other activities to pass the time.

5. Post-Treatment Care

After the cooling applicator is removed, your medical professional may perform a short massage on the treated area to enhance the treatment's efficacy. You may experience some redness, swelling, or numbness in the treated area, but these sensations are generally mild and temporary. You can resume your daily activities immediately after the procedure, as cryolipolysis requires no downtime.

Results and Follow-up Treatments

The results of cryolipolysis are not immediate, as the body takes time to eliminate the targeted fat cells naturally. Typically, you will begin to notice gradual improvements in the treated area within a few weeks after the treatment. However, the full results may take up to three months to become apparent.

The number of treatment sessions required varies depending on individual needs and desired outcomes. In some cases, a single session may be sufficient, while others may benefit from multiple sessions spaced several weeks apart. Your medical professional will guide you on the optimal treatment plan based on your specific goals and body composition.

Factors Affecting Treatment Time

Several factors can influence the time required for cryolipolysis treatment:

1. Size of the Treatment Area

The size of the area being treated can impact the treatment duration. Larger areas may require more time to ensure thorough cooling and maximum effectiveness. For example, treating the abdomen may take longer than treating the chin.

2. Number of Areas Being Treated

If you are targeting multiple areas during the same session, it will naturally extend the treatment time. However, treating multiple areas simultaneously can be more time-efficient overall.

3. Individual Response to Treatment

Every individual's body responds differently to cryolipolysis. Factors such as metabolism, tissue composition, and overall health can influence how quickly the body eliminates the targeted fat cells. While some may see noticeable results sooner, others may experience a more gradual transformation.

4. Practitioner's Expertise

The skill and expertise of the medical professional performing the cryolipolysis treatment can also impact the timeframe. Experienced practitioners are typically more efficient and can minimize treatment time while ensuring optimal results.

Cost Considerations

The cost of cryolipolysis in Hobart can vary depending on various factors, including the number of treatment areas and the clinic's reputation. On average, a single cryolipolysis session can range from $500 to $1,000 per treatment area. However, it is crucial to discuss the exact pricing with your chosen provider during the initial consultation, as they can provide you with a personalized quote based on your individual goals and needs.
